Some things in life start as a joke and end in discovery. This is one of those things.

While exploring Newfoundland, camera in one hand and zero expectations in the other, I walked into a local grocery store. Nothing fancy. Just one of those shops where the lighting flickers a bit and the produce section smells like earth. And there, surrounded by shelves of unfamiliar snacks, I had a spontaneous thought: what if I asked a Canadian, a real local Canadian, what their favorite chocolate is? No pretense. No YouTube challenge vibe. Just one honest question.

So I did exactly that. I walked up to strangers and said, “You’re Canadian, right? What’s your favorite type of Canadian candy?” And just like that, the idea snowballed. The rules were simple. It had to be chocolate. No gummies. No sour strips. No maple-flavored elk jerky. Just honest to goodness Canadian chocolate, recommended by the people who know it best.

Which brings us to our first contender in this great northern taste test: a Cadbury bar.

Yes. Cadbury. The company you might associate with those oddly satisfying Easter eggs. But apparently, up here, Cadbury makes more than just seasonal treats. They make proper bars. Full sized. Wrapped like royalty. And, according to the locals I met, worthy of being crowned a Canadian favorite.

The first impression was solid. Literally and figuratively. The bar looked clean. Structured. Like something that takes itself seriously without trying too hard. The smell? Rich. Smooth. That classic cocoa scent that makes your brain whisper childhood memories you did not know were still hanging around.

And the taste?

That was the real surprise.

Creamy. Full bodied. Not overly sweet like American chocolate tends to be. Just… balanced. The kind of chocolate that feels engineered for slow bites and quiet evenings. It melts the way good chocolate should melt. Not instantly, not grudgingly, but like it knows the pace of the moment.

There was something nostalgic in it. Maybe it was the texture. Maybe it was the setting. Or maybe it was just the realization that sometimes, the simplest things, a stranger’s recommendation, a bar of chocolate, can anchor you to a place in ways you never expect.
